**14:42** — Support escalated reports that undo in the Sketchloom diagram editor was replaying stale node positions after a redo. We confirmed the history stack was being truncated on autosave, discarding redo entries silently. Marta rolled the canvas service back to the prior build. The identifier for that build is recorded below.

pipeline stamp: htk31_f769b577b3028a4e9958e5bb8d1259a

The Fernwell schema-migration service for Project Larkspur cannot proceed with the zero-downtime column backfill because the credentials vault sealed itself after three failed unseal attempts during last night's maintenance window. The dual-write phase is paused safely, so no customer impact yet, but the shadow table will drift if we wait past 48 hours. Support should unseal using the documented recovery flow before resuming step 6. The passphrase required for the unseal is provided below.

unlock words, hahip-yagef: zorok-novmir-zorix-silax

Runbook: turnstile counter, Harrowfield Arena. The gate-count service aggregates turnstile pulses from all 14 entrances and pushes totals to the ops dashboard every 30s. If counts flatline, restart the aggregator pod first; hardware faults are rarer than pod crashes. After restart, the aggregator must re-authenticate to the pulse broker or it silently drops readings — this burned us twice last season. Verify the aggregator's env file on the gate host includes this line:

sealed setting: VAULT_KEY20=dd440a383707adecf165

Subject: Quickstore 4.2 — bloom filter now fronts the KV layer

Plugin authors: starting with this release, Quickstore places a bloom filter ahead of the key-value store. Negative lookups return faster; false positives fall through safely. No API changes are required on your side. Verify your plugin against the staging build referenced below.

session token of fahif-tadup = htk3_9c7